Howard – Week 3 5X4 Photography


In this lesson we learned how to use a Sinar 5X4 camera to photography people in the style of Julia Margret Cameron photographs. We used 5X4 black and white paper to produce a negative like Fox Talbot.
            The paper had an ISO of 6, so we needed a long exposure of about 5-8 seconds at aperture F8. The process to take the images is that we had to pull up the dark slide to take the photograph, then pull the shutter lever towards ourselves, set the shutter speed to the ‘T’ setting on the camera. Then press the shutter twice to take the photograph. Then we go to the darkroom and go through the process of developing it.
            After we decided to do a reverse print using another sheet of paper and a contact frame. Then develop the picture.
